So what actually causes your hair to become frizzy the next morning when you wake up? When sleeping, tossing and turning causes hair to rub against the pillow, creating friction. Such friction caused by the pillow is called Pillow Friction. Pillow Friction causes the hair cuticles to open up unevenly, resulting in rough, frizzy or prone to tangles hair. These hair damage caused by pillow friction are known as Pillow Damage. As a result of Pillow Damage, bed hair occurs (or "lion mane", as most people would call it).

To solve this problem, you usually have no choice but to wash your hair in the morning. Washing your
hair ‘resets’ the uneven alignment of hair cuticles and makes hair smooth and manageable again.
However, by having to wash hair in the morning, you would have to wake earlier and sacrifice your beauty sleep. Now here's an alternative solution to the bed hair caused by Pillow Damage: Essential Sleeping Hair
Mask. It protects each hair strand and minimizes Pillow Damage when you toss and turn about when sleeping.
